Job Title: Accounts Officer
Location: Lagos, Nigeria
Employment Type: Contract (3 Months)
Industry: Oil & Gas
JOB SUMMARY
We are seeking a detail-oriented and results-driven Accounts Officer to support the Finance & Accounts department by processing daily accounting transactions, maintaining accurate financial records using Sage Accounting Software, supporting bank reconciliations, statutory tax compliance, financial reporting, and internal and external audits.
RESPONSIBILITIES
- Record daily financial transactions in Sage and maintain the general ledger, journals, accruals, prepayments, and supporting documentation.
- Process supplier invoices, verify approvals, prepare payment schedules, reconcile statements, and monitor outstanding payables.
- Prepare customer invoices, monitor collections, follow up on overdue balances, and maintain receivables ageing schedules.
- Post daily cash and bank transactions and perform monthly bank reconciliations, investigating and resolving discrepancies.
- Assist with monthly management accounts, trial balance, Income Statement, Statement of Financial Position, Cash Flow, and budget variance reports.
- Support month-end and year-end closing activities.
- Support preparation and filing of PAYE, VAT, WHT, Pension, NSITF, ITF, and NHF schedules where applicable.
- Ensure statutory remittances are accurately computed, processed on time, and properly documented.
- Prepare audit schedules, respond to audit queries, support auditors, and assist with implementation of audit recommendations.
- Ensure compliance with financial policies, proper transaction authorization, confidentiality, and internal controls.
- Maintain accurate electronic and physical financial records and support regulatory inspections and management reviews.
- Recommend improvements to accounting processes, documentation, SOPs, and finance systems.
- Perform other finance-related duties as assigned.
